Jon Owens, known by his
stage name Casual, is an Americanrapper . Born inOakland ,California , Owens is a member of the influentialalternative hip hop collective Hieroglyphics. In addition, he has released five full-length LPs over the span of his twelve year career. Although none of his solo releases have achieved significant commercial success, Owens has garnered a following amongst devoted hip hop fans, partially due to the rise in popularity ofBay Area hip hop.Biography
1994's "Fear Itself" is of significance to Owens' career. It is his only major label-marketed album and features various members of his crew,
Hieroglyphics , on vocals and production. The album also features a prominent cameo from Bay Area rapperSaafir . The album follows a traditional format: its songs adhere to a verse-chorus-verse arrangement, and the up-tempo and slower tracks are contrasted against each other. The popularity of the album's second single, "I Didn't Mean To" exposed Owens to a wider audience. He released three follow-up albums after "Fear Itself", one of which ("He Think He Raw") was distributed by Sony-affiliated distributor Red Urban. [ [http://wc03.allmusic.com/cg/amg.dll?p=amg&sql=11:kxfuxqqgldae~T2 allmusic ((( Casual > Discography > Main Albums ))) ] ] Owens is now a community activist. In 2006, he took on a role as Music Production and Media Arts Consultant at Youth Uprising [ [http://www.Youthuprising.org Welcome to Youth Uprising ] ] . Jonathan Owens currently holds a seat on the City of Oakland Board of Cultural Affairs. Owens is also CEO of Hiero Jeans. [ [http://www.hierojeans.com/ Hiero Jeans ] ]Discography
